Redundancy and Randomization as Effective Tools for Improving Performance

Redundancy is widely used for fault tolerance: storing multiple copies of data, executing the same instructions on multiple processors, providing alternate paths in a communication network, etc. However, redundancy can also be used for improving performance and even cost-performance. In some cases, combining it with randomization is highly beneficial: randomization makes performance insensitive to specific scenarios (e.g., balances average load), and redundancy is used to handle the rare “bad” cases. Moreover, this approach often results in the ideal combination of “selfish” policies with “good citizenship”. We illustrate this using examples from our own past research, and offer important insights. The ideas are applicable to numerous fields.
